Effects of a new immunodepressant J2 on lymphocytic secretion of interleukin 10 and interferon gamma in mice after corneal allograft

Abstract:

BACKGROUND: J2 is a new immunodepressant targeting CD4, and previous studies have verified the effect of J2 on spleen cells of normal mice or mice undergoing corneal transplantation.
OBJECTIVE: To investigate the effects of J2 on the lymphocytic secretion of interferon gamma (IFN-γ) and interleukin 10 (IL-10) of mice with allogeneic corneal transplantation.
METHODS: Corneal transplantation models were created in the right eyes of 36 clean BalB/c(H2d) mice (receiptors) and 17 clean C57BL/6(H2b) mice (donors). The models were randomly divided into four groups according to the different intervene methods. Corneal opacification and neovascularization were scored. The proliferation of spleen cells of mice was detected by ATPase method, and secretion of IL-10 and IFN- γ in cytosupernatant before and after ConA stimulated were assessed by ELISA. 
RESULTS AND CONCLUSION: J2 arrest the occurrence of corneal rejection by inhibiting the activation of CD4+ T cells and suppress the proliferation and ConA-stimulated Th1 cytokine production of spleen cells.
